Sanders, Datko, Harris look good at FSU’s pro day

Eleven players worked out for representatives from 19 NFL teams at Florida State’s pro day on March 14.
Here’s how some of the more notable prospects performed:
Zebrie Sanders, OT (6-foot-5 1/2, 314 pounds) — Sanders has 34 5/8-inch arms, which is a good indicator of future success as a pro. He must improve his strength, but he looked very good in position drills and projects as a second-round pick.
Andrew Datko, OT (6-5 1/8, 316) — Datko did 20 strength reps. He performed position drills, answering questions about whether he can pass a physical after he had shoulder surgery last year.
Mike Harris, CB (5-10 3/8, 184) — Harris ran the 40-yard dash in 4.53 and 4.55 seconds, although he plays faster than that. Harris had a good workout and could be a third-day pick.
Nigel Bradham, LB (6-2 1/8, 241) — Bradham looked good in position drills.
Beau Reliford, TE (6-5 5/8, 258) — Did not work out because of a sports hernia.
